Is marketing an art or a science? The answer is yes. Marketing is both – an art and a science. Enjoy this point and counter point about the art and science of marketing. Use the strengths of both arguments to better understand and improve your marketing.

Marketing Science
Marketing is a science because marketing is about understanding and influencing behaviors. Psychology, the science of behaviors, studies how people react to certain stimuli in predictable ways. This is similar to Newton’s’ third law – cause and effect. For every marketing action there is a reaction. The science is in anticipating the reactions to your actions.

Marketing Art
Marketing is an art because marketing is about appreciating the nuances of human behaviors. Beauty is in the eye of the beholder. Beauty is art.

Marketing Science
Marketing is a science because marketing is about measuring and analyzing the numbers. How many prospects do you reach? How many people read your message? How many do you convert to buyers? How much do they spend? How many buy again? These are mathematical questions and answers and important to the success of your marketing. Math and accounting are important sciences to your business.

Marketing Art
Marketing is art because marketing is about creating a demand for your product. Some of that demand is immediate and some of it is in the future. You can try to use science to predict the future part but you might pick a number based on art. There is always an unknown aspect that we attribute to art.

Marketing Science
Marketing is a science because the most common question is “How much money should I spend on marketing?” The business owner and the accountants want the answer to this question. It’s a good question but the more important question is, “What return can you expect from your marketing investment?” That’s an important question and it is measurable like science.

Marketing Art
Marketing is an art because there is the issue of branding which is difficult to measure. To generate a good return on your marketing investment requires a creative approach. That means that you need to apply the art of marketing. That is difficult to measure but it is necessary.

Of course the argument of science versus art could go on. Is it art? Is it science?

I believe that many marketers try to portray marketing as art when they can’t measure their results. Hence they give up responsibility for their marketing programs. They suggest that marketing is all chance. Many self-declared branding experts talk about the art of branding and refuse to face the science of measurement. Don’t be fooled by that hocus pocus.

I believe that marketing is a science that should draw upon the art. Never let art dictate the direction of your marketing. Use science to determine major decisions and use the art for the nuances.

Is marketing a science or art? I believe that it is both art and science. Most importantly the science should lead and measure; the art should inspire and create.

That is the art and science of marketing.

PHILOSOPHY OF TECHNOLOGY
A Reflection
By
VIKRAM KARVE

In our everyday lives most of us use a number of words which we assume have a universal, agreed-upon, and accepted meaning for all people in all contexts.

Often, the more frequently the word is used more we take for granted that our usage is the only possible usage of the term.

One word which belongs in this category is “technology.”

The vast majority view technology as machines, computers and other forms of modern hardware – the province of the scientist, engineer or specialist professional.

We have to transcend this narrow view of technology since every technology starts from a human purpose, from the intention to satisfy some human need or behaviour.

Indeed, technology is the manipulation of nature for human purpose.

Now man is also a part of nature and by manipulating nature man is manipulating himself.

Thus, technology manipulates man and influences, even governs, human behaviour and in turn societal behaviour.

It is therefore imperative to reconceptualise the concept of technology by viewing it though the philosophical lens in order to understand the “soft” social, cultural, individual, psychological, behavioural and intellectual dimensions of technology in contrast to the “hard” technical dimension.

Language is a “soft” technology, an invented system of communication. Alvin Tofler specifically discussed “political technologies” in his description of “Third Wave” changes in our world environment. Indeed, “soft” technologies take many forms. They include the invention of social institutions – methods of organizing people for the achievement of particular ends.

Arthur Harkins defines “culture” as the metasystem or system of systems of human-invented and hereditarily transmitted technologies, and further emphasizes that human have codified technologies into what anthropologists call culture.

Even more fundamentally, or expansively, technologies are philosophies, ideologies. Ways of thinking, or world-views (Weltanschauungen). The key realization is that technologies are way of structuring and ordering the world.

This philosophical reconceptualisation of technology entails a broader image wherein technologies are viewed not merely as physical or technical apparatuses but as inseparably interconnected with the fabric of social policy, values and desires and are in fact complex constellations of devices, processes, beliefs and mechanisms which are perceived as a system of interrelated innovations comprising a coherent nexus pertaining to the systematic manipulation of nature.

Technologies reconceptualised from the philosophical viewpoint are mutually supportive and harmonically attuned process and philosophies for synergistically aiding the individual or society to reach specific, hopefully preferred, future states; they are instruments for attaining and integrating the proposal future with the perceived present.

Since technology is essentially invented rather than discovered, such a reconceptualisation would help to introduce a premium for creativity and divergent thought into the academic world alongside the traditional emphasis on scholarly research and the quest for truth and would encourage cross-fertilization across disciplinary boundaries.

It may be apt to conclude with a comment by RM Pirsig, who states that: “The way to solve the conflict between human values and technological needs is not to run away from technology. That’s impossible. The way to resolve the conflict is to break down the barriers of dualistic thought that prevent a real understanding of what technology is… not an exploitation of nature, but a fusion of nature and the human spirit into a new kind of creation that transcends both”.

The knowledge that a resource exists plays an important factor governing its exploitation.

Technology plays an important role here in making it possible to find and exploit an accumulation of matter and/or energy as a resource. Some accumulations may not be recognised as a resource until there is an advance in technology, which may be driven by market forces. In his treatment of non-renewable resources, Hotelling (1931) did not consider the possibility of replacement of a resource by exploration for new sources. Instead, the resource was treated as a fixed stock. In fact, over much of the modern era, non-renewable resources have been discovered at faster rates than they have been depleted, which has made them appear more like renewable resources. The role of technology in exploiting resources is of fundamental importance to the economics of resources. As a particular resource becomes scarce, market forces should operate to raise its price. While it has been claimed that there is little evidence for this (Barnett and Morse 1963; Barnett 1979), experience following the oil price rise of 1973 would seem to corroborate this view. As oil was made artificially scarce by cuts in production by the Organisation of Petroleum Exporting Countries and its price rose, more effort was devoted to finding substitutes for it in certain uses.

Technology provides the means to exploit new resources as they are discovered. As the world moves on, human knowledge is extended and technology improves, accumulations of matter and/or energy, which were previously overlooked as resources, may become ‘useful’. Oil occurred in surface deposits in parts of the ancient world, such as modern day Iraq, but was regarded as a concentrated pollutant in that it had no use and was potentially harmful. In the same way barytes, which was once discarded from lead mines has now become a useful resource in the process of oil drilling. Knowledge of the existence of an accumulation and of its potential use as a resource is of obvious importance economically. Clearly it is a prerequisite of natural resource exploitation that knowledge of the existence of a resource must obtain before a resource can be exploited.

The technology to enable that exploitation must also be available. There are many examples of potential resources that are not currently exploited because the technology to do so economically does not yet exist. In the past, oil from beneath the seabed has been just such an example. Children are natural scientists, always discovering and absorbing new things. Parents can help their children by supplying them with the appropriate science supplies so that they can make a better sense of what they see in the world. Science is trying to explain what you see. Parental involvement in anything; be it sports; school supplies or some hobby is the real key to success for every child. When education supplies are involved a child will set off in new directions with an exceptional level of confidence.

Encourage Them

Children are full of questions. Life is a library of new information for them to go through a day without wondering about something. You should not only be receptive to their questions at all times, but you should go as far as to encourage them to ask. Taking your child seriously and listening with respect is crucial to learning.

No Need to Be a Scientist

Parents often have the false notion that they need to be a science expert themselves, or have answers to all of their child’s questions. The fact is, it is constructive to make the science subject easier and interesting with the science supplies. There are different kinds of supplies available on the market for the better understanding of the wonderful subject. These are Science Boards, Science Equipment, Life Science, Human Anatomy, Health & Nutrition, Microscopes & Magnifiers, Nature Studies, Environment & Weather, Charts, Lab Equipment, Optics & Light, Slide Strips, Project Boards, Science Kits, Space Science and Science Fairs & Experiments. Science is all about experimentation and discovery. And, these supplies will demonstrate the value of learning new things.

Science is not that hard, as perceived

Another biggest yet false notion about science is that it is difficult. The idea of science often conjures up images of beakers, test tubes and burners. True, science can get complex at higher levels, but the bottom line is that science is an art of discovering what you don’t know already. Learning how to find answers to interesting questions is what science is all about.

It is never too late

Science is everywhere. The most useful tool for beginning science is supplying your children with essential science supplies.

It is a fun to participate in your child science education. You do not necessarily have to be a scientist, or have lots of facts in your head. All you need is a love of invention and exploration. Show your child that it is good to be curious and to ask questions. You might even rediscover a few wonderful things for yourself.
